Enterprise extended their losing streak to nine on Tuesday, dropping their season record down to 8-19 in the process. They lost 6-0 to the Red Bluff Spartans.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Spartans this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 14-3 on Tuesday.
As for Red Bluff, they have been performing incredibly well recently as they've won ten of their last 11 contests. That's provided a massive bump to their 15-9 record this season. Those vict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 3.7 runs on average over those games.
For Red Bluff's part, they got a great performance from Ever Ovalle as he didn't allow a single earned run while striking out 12 over six innings pitched. Those 12 strikeouts gave Ovalle a new career-high.
At the plate, Red Bluff let Lucas Owens and Ryan Ross run wild. Owens went 3-for-4 with one run and one double, while Ross went 2-for-4 with two runs and one RBI. The team also got some help courtesy of Jaret Bridwell, who went a perfect 2-for-2 with one stolen base and one run.
While Enterprise had to take the loss, they won't have to wait long to give it another shot: the pair's next game is a rematch scheduled at 4:00 p.m. on Friday.
